The core of Indian culture remains rooted in family relations, which are traditionally patrilineal and multi-generational. The "Double Burden"

: Many modern Indian women balance "instrumental" professional roles with "expressive" caregiving roles. Even as they pursue careers, they are often expected to manage household responsibilities and maintain family honor. Decision-Making and Autonomy

: Autonomy varies significantly by region. Women in North-Eastern states often enjoy higher levels of household decision-making (up to 99% in some areas) compared to other regions. Changing Perspectives

: Education is a primary driver of change; college-educated adults are significantly less likely to hold traditional views on rigid gender roles, such as the idea that childcare should be exclusively a woman's responsibility. Pew Research Center

Modern Indian women are increasingly breaking barriers in sectors once considered inaccessible.

Political Empowerment: India has one of the world's largest pools of elected women leaders, with nearly half of representatives in local governance (Panchayati Raj) being women.

Economic Drivers: Millions of women are part of Self-Help Groups (SHGs) and rural enterprises, such as the "Didi Ki Rasoi" in Bihar or animal healthcare workers in Jharkhand.

In 2026, the line between "traditional" and "daily wear" has blurred, with a heavy focus on comfort and rewearability.

Indo-Western Fusion: The most common weekday look for women aged 20–35 is a printed short kurti paired with jeans or trousers.

Functional Innovation: Pre-stitched and "ready-to-wear" sarees have become essential for busy women, offering the elegance of a drape in under five minutes.

Sustainability: There is a massive shift toward eco-friendly fabrics like organic cotton, khadi, and bamboo silk.

At the heart of an Indian woman’s life is the concept of Sanskriti (culture) and family. For many, life is centered around the multi-generational household. Whether in a rural village or a high-rise in Mumbai, the Indian woman is often the "glue" of the family, managing intricate social networks and maintaining domestic traditions.

However, the "stay-at-home" trope is rapidly evolving. Modern Indian women are increasingly balancing traditional roles with high-powered careers, leading to a unique "dual identity" where they might lead a corporate boardroom by day and perform a traditional Aarti (prayer ritual) at home by night. Culinary Traditions and Health

Food is a primary expression of love and culture. Indian women are the custodians of regional recipes that have been passed down for centuries. From the fermented idlis of the South to the rich parathas of the North, the kitchen remains a space of immense skill and cultural preservation.

In recent years, there has been a resurgence in traditional wellness. Many women are returning to Ayurveda—incorporating turmeric, neem, and seasonal eating into their daily routines. Indian fashion is perhaps the most visible aspect of this cultural blend. The Sari remains a symbol of grace and national identity, with each state boasting its own weave (like Banarasi, Kanjeevaram, or Chanderi).

Yet, the daily wardrobe of the contemporary Indian woman is diverse. The Kurta paired with jeans is the "uniform" of the working woman, while the younger generation in cities like Bangalore and Delhi embraces global trends, blending them with Indian silhouettes—a style often called "Indo-Western." Education and Economic Empowerment

The last few decades have seen a massive shift in the aspirations of Indian women. With rising literacy rates, women are entering fields like tech, space exploration (evident in ISRO’s missions), and entrepreneurship at record rates. "Self-Help Groups" (SHGs) in rural areas have also empowered millions of women to become financially independent, fundamentally changing the power dynamics within rural households. Festivals and Spiritual Life

Culture is most vibrant during festivals like Diwali, Eid, Holi, or Navratri. For Indian women, these are not just religious events but social ones. They are occasions for elaborate Mehendi (henna) designs, heavy jewelry, and community dancing (like Garba). Traditional Roles and Expectations

In Indian society, women have traditionally been expected to play multiple roles, often simultaneously. They are expected to be dutiful daughters, caring mothers, and devoted wives. The concept of "Pativrata" or devotion to one's husband is deeply ingrained in Indian culture. Women are often socialized to prioritize their family's needs over their own, and their self-worth is frequently tied to their roles as caregivers and homemakers.

Changing Times and Evolving Roles

However, with the passage of time, Indian women's roles have undergone significant changes. As the country has modernized and urbanized, women have increasingly entered the workforce, pursued higher education, and taken on leadership positions. Today, Indian women can be found in various professions, from medicine and engineering to business and politics. South Indian Women : In southern India, women

Diverse Cultural Practices

India's diverse cultural landscape is reflected in the various traditions and practices that shape women's lives. For example:

  1. South Indian Women: In southern India, women often wear traditional sarees and adorn themselves with intricate jewelry. They play a vital role in preserving traditional arts, such as Bharatanatyam (classical dance) and Carnatic music.
  2. Punjabi Women: In Punjab, women are known for their vibrant fashion sense, often wearing colorful salwar kameez and ornate jewelry. They are also renowned for their contributions to agriculture and entrepreneurship.
  3. Tribal Women: In India's tribal communities, women play a crucial role in preserving traditional knowledge and practices. They are often involved in agriculture, forest management, and handicraft production.

Challenges and Opportunities

Despite the progress made, Indian women continue to face numerous challenges, including:

  1. Gender Inequality: Women still face significant disparities in education, employment, and healthcare.
  2. Violence and Harassment: Indian women are often vulnerable to various forms of violence and harassment, including domestic abuse and street harassment.
  3. Social and Cultural Constraints: Women may face restrictions on their mobility, dress, and choices, particularly in rural areas.

However, there are also opportunities for growth and empowerment:

  1. Education and Skill Development: Initiatives aimed at promoting women's education and skill development have led to increased participation in the workforce and entrepreneurship.
  2. Government Policies and Schemes: The Indian government has launched various schemes, such as the Beti Bachao Beti Padhao (Save the Girl, Educate the Girl) program, to promote women's education and empowerment.
  3. Women's Movements and Activism: The rise of women's movements and activism has helped raise awareness about women's rights and issues, leading to increased advocacy and support.
